Resumo

In mechanical assembly of two wheels vehicles, requesting a major efforts systems is the steering column. The theoretical and experimental approaches, column of weldability parameter, are developed and analyzed in the automotive for the quantitative determination of weld solidification variables, such as current, voltage, speed and power rating, and subsequently, diluting, height, depth and heat affected zone. The paper also analyzes the weld bead tensions in relation to harmful external variables its effectiveness. These parameters are compared with other models within their standards and welding specifications. The experimental results are obtained through metallographic test macrograph and mechanical tests in steering columns.
